Specificity Comments:
Recognizes a cell surface glycoprotein of 95/115/135 kDa (depending upon glycosylation), identified as CD43 [Workshop IV].
70–90% of T-cell lymphomas and 22–37% of B-cell lymphomas express CD43. No reactivity with reactive B-cells.
Co-expression of CD43 in B-lineage cells suggests malignant lymphoma rather than reactive B-cell population.
Combined use with anti-CD20 enables effective immunophenotyping of lymphomas in formalin-fixed tissues.
Co-staining with anti-CD20 and anti-CD43 supports lymphoma diagnosis over reactive process.
Target Information
CD43 (leukosialin, sialophorin) is a transmembrane mucin-like protein with high negative charge, expressed on most hematopoietic cells.
It contributes to a repulsive barrier interfering with adhesion but can promote leukocyte aggregation.
Through interaction with actin-binding proteins ezrin and moesin, CD43 regulates T-cell morphology and lymphocyte traffic.
CD43 signaling enhances LFA-1 adhesiveness and modulates its induction.
Expression of CD43 can induce tumor suppressor p53; however, in p53/ARF deficiency, it may promote tumor proliferation.
Associated diseases include Wiscott-Aldrich Syndrome and Adenoid Basal Cell Carcinoma.
